Who can trust the General Counsel?

Gurpartap Basra, Co-founder & CEO of GC Connected, explores the role of trust as the cornerstone of a General Counsel’s influence and shares some key principles in earning that trust in the moments that matter most.

“Trust is like a vase… once it’s broken, though you can fix it, the vase will never be the same again.”
– Walter Inglis Anderson (American painter, 1903-1965)

That line wasn’t written for General Counsel – but it could have been.

Every decision, every conversation, every moment of silence builds or breaks the trust that defines your credibility as a GC.
Because once trust cracks – even slightly – everything changes.

Trust, for a General Counsel, is more than a personal value. It’s the foundation of influence.
Without it, your advice is questioned.
With it, your leadership reaches beyond the legal function.

“Being right is expected. Being understood is what makes you credible.”

But how does a GC actually build and sustain that trust?
Here’s 6 pointers:

1. Deliver clarity in a world of complexity.
The most trusted GCs do not overwhelm leaders with legal risk; they give them clarity.
When business partners walk away from a conversation with certainty instead of confusion, trust compounds.

2. Balance judgment with empathy.
Technical precision matters but so does human understanding.
People trust those who can read a room as well as they can read a contract.
Being right is expected. Being understood is what makes you credible.

3. Speak the truth – especially when it’s uncomfortable.
Trust is tested in moments of tension.
It’s in those times when a GC must say, “This may not be what you want to hear, but it’s what you need to know.”
Courage builds trust. Silence erodes it.

4. Be consistent in values, not opinions.
Boards and CEOs trust predictability of principle.
Even if they do not always like your answer, they will respect that your reasoning is rooted in integrity, not convenience.

5. Build trust in small moments.
Follow up when you say you will.
Be discreet with what is shared.
Show calm under pressure.
Every small action is a deposit – or withdrawal – from your trust account.

6. Lead with transparency and humanity.
In uncertainty, the GC’s steadiness becomes the company’s anchor.
Openness about risk, honesty about limits, and calm communication build trust not just in your judgment but in your character.

Trust is not built in statements.
It’s built in moments – the quiet ones, the hard ones, the human ones.me.
